Brooke Bellamy dropped as girls’ entrepreneur program ambassador after RecipeTin Eats plagiarism allegations
Influencer baker Brooke Bellamy has been dropped as an ambassador for a federally funded program to teach girls to “think like an entrepreneur” after cookbook author Nagi Maehashi accused her of plagiarism.
